About Tamadoggo

FreemiumBeginner-friendlyNo APIWeb · Mobile

Tamadoggo is a smart pet journal that turns everyday moments with your dog or cat into a living story. It blends a warm, illustrated timeline with a medical tracker, letting you log vet visits, walks, weight, food, meds, and milestones across twelve categories. The AI quietly analyzes your entries to spot health patterns—like a limp, a scratching uptick, or a shift in energy—and surfaces them as gentle insights, never alarms. It also scans vet receipts and vaccination records, lifting diagnoses, dosages, and dates directly onto the timeline as structured entries, saving you tedious admin. Designed for families, Tamadoggo lets you invite up to six people per pet to co-keep the same journal via a private link, with 'Added by' badges showing who logged what. The Tamagotchi-style 'Crib' gives your pet an illustrated home screen where every object opens a feature—timeline, scrapbook, calendar, medical bag, food bowl, scale, and a crystal ball for quiet AI insights. With 16 personalities (10 dogs, 6 cats), each with unique art, the interface feels playful and personal, not clinical. Its 'no streaks, no guilt' philosophy means logging is optional, and the monthly AI letter (Pro) is a warm recap you can export as a PDF for your vet. Compared to clinical trackers like Pawtrack or generic habit apps, Tamadoggo prioritizes warmth, family collaboration, and a gamified experience. It's available on iOS (web signup works) with an Android app coming soon. The free tier covers core journaling and sharing; Pro adds AI breed detection (dogs only), breed-aware reminders, and the monthly AI letters. It's built for pet parents who want a meaningful keepsake as much as a practical tool.

Behind the Verdict

Tamadoggo succeeds because it understands the emotional side of pet ownership. The timeline is genuinely pleasant to scroll—photos, notes, and milestones flow together, and the AI summaries are warmly written, using your pet's name and avoiding alarmist language. The Crib is a delightful touch: each object opens a feature, making the app feel like a game rather than a chore. For families, the sharing feature is a killer: up to six people can co-keep a journal with a private link, and 'Added by' badges keep credit clear. The AI document scanning is impressive: photograph a vet receipt and it extracts diagnoses, vaccines, dosages, and dates into structured timeline entries. Where Tamadoggo falls short: it's iOS-centric (Android app is listed on Google Play but may still be maturing), and integrations are nonexistent—no veterinary practice systems, no wearables, no Zapier. If you're a data-driven owner who wants to export records to a vet portal or sync with a fitness tracker, you'll be disappointed. The AI insights are intentionally gentle, so they may miss critical signals you'd want more assertive. Breed detection is dog-only, and the monthly letter is Pro-only. The pricing is straightforward: Free covers unlimited timeline entries, AI document scanning, photos (up to 3 per entry), family sharing, manual reminders, and all 16 personalities. Pro adds the monthly AI letter (PDF export), breed detection for dogs, and breed-aware reminders—but the Pro price is not listed on the homepage, which is a transparency miss. Given the 'no streaks, no guilt' philosophy, it's a low-pressure app that fits casual loggers and devoted keepers alike.

Hidden costs & gotchas

What the public pricing page doesn't put in bold. Captured from pricing-page footnotes, contract terms, and recurring complaints.

  • Pro price is not listed on the homepage; you have to sign up to see it, which may surprise budget-conscious buyers.
  • AI breed detection is only for dogs; cat owners pay for Pro without getting that feature.
  • The monthly AI letter is Pro-only, so free users miss the signature feature.
  • Family sharing is limited to 6 people per pet; larger families or multi-pet households may hit the cap.
  • Data is stored in the EU; if you're outside Europe, you may have privacy concerns about cross-border data transfer.
